Mangrove Spire

The colorful collage within the translucent plexiglass embodies the filtration and transformation of water within the tower. Like a mangrove absorbing and filtering nutrients, the layered elements visualize how water is never static—it collects, changes, and influences its surroundings. Each hue represents a different state: fog, rain, and tides, interacting within the architectural system. The transparency of the plexiglass allows these transformations to be felt rather than seen directly, mirroring how water shapes environments over time.
